step 4. post-reading activity
task1: locate the places in the map
(teacher shows a blank map of england on the screen. ask them to locate the position of some places . ex.1 on p 36)
task 2:discussion
t: now you've known much information about england. it's known to all of you that england is separated from european mainland by the english channel. is it possible to swim across the channel? where is the best place to do so? how far is it? please have a discussion in groups of four.
(suggested answers: it's possible to swim across the english channel though it is very difficult. now there are many people in the world who have swum across the channel. last july, zhang jian in our country was also successful in doing so. the best place where they swim across the channel is from dover in england to gallet in france. it is 33.8 kilometers. …)
